It is with heavy hearts that we share the passing of our beloved mom, Milagros “Mila” Raymundo, after a courageous and inspiring battle with glioblastoma.

Our mom’s story is one of love, strength, and unwavering kindness. She met our dad, Richard, when they were just teenagers in high school. What started as a sweet courtship blossomed into a long-distance love story. In 1987, our dad proposed, and they married the following year in 1988. Shortly after, Mom made the brave decision to leave her home in the Philippines and begin a new life with Dad in the U.S.

Together, they built a beautiful life. She gave birth to me, Chynna, and my brother, Joseph. Despite being far from her family, Mom always stayed connected to her roots. She supported her loved ones in the Philippines however she could. Her generosity knew no borders.

Anyone who met my mom would tell you how kind she was. She had a mother’s heart not just for her own children, but for anyone who needed a little extra care, warmth, or a listening ear. She became a second mom to many, and a trusted friend to even more. At work, she was known for planning joyful office parties, lifting spirits, and being the one people always turned to. She had a gentle strength and comforting presence that made others feel safe and seen.

In May 2023, Mom was diagnosed with glioblastoma, an aggressive form of brain cancer. She faced the diagnosis with courage and determination, undergoing surgery, radiation, and chemotherapy. For a while, her tumor was under control. But in September 2024, she was hospitalized again, and doctors discovered two new tumors. Still, she never gave up. She fought hard until the very end, showing us all what true strength and grace look like.
